一、技术定位:本地化AI智能体的核心特征
Clawdbot的突破性在于构建了完整的本地化AI执行框架,其技术架构可拆解为三个核心层:
-
通信中间件层
通过标准化协议与主流IM工具(如企业级即时通讯平台)深度集成,支持多账号并发管理。开发者可通过配置文件定义消息路由规则,例如将特定关键词的对话自动转发至任务处理模块,实现聊天与任务执行的解耦。 -
任务调度引擎
采用分层任务模型设计,将用户请求拆解为原子操作(如文件读取、API调用)与组合任务(如数据清洗+可视化生成)。引擎内置依赖解析器,可自动处理任务间的时序关系,例如在执行代码编译前先检查环境依赖。 -
安全沙箱环境
为防范恶意指令风险,系统构建了双重防护机制:
- 静态指令分析:通过正则表达式过滤危险操作(如系统目录删除)
- 动态权限控制:基于RBAC模型实现细粒度权限管理,例如限制普通用户仅能访问指定目录的文档
典型部署方案中,开发者可在Linux服务器上通过Docker容器快速启动服务,配置示例如下:
version: '3.8'services:clawdbot:image: clawdbot:latestvolumes:- ./config:/app/config- /home/user/data:/app/dataenvironment:- IM_PLATFORM=enterprise_chat- API_KEY=your_key_hereports:- "8080:8080"
二、核心能力解析:从对话到执行的完整闭环
Clawdbot实现了三大类关键能力,构建起完整的人机协作链路:
1. 多模态交互能力
- 自然语言理解:集成预训练语言模型,支持上下文感知的对话管理。例如在连续对话中可记住前文提到的文件路径,无需重复输入完整指令。
- 多通道反馈:任务执行结果通过图文混合消息返回,代码错误会附带堆栈跟踪信息,数据查询结果支持表格化展示。
2. 系统级操作集成
- 文件系统操作:支持递归目录遍历、格式转换(如PDF转Word)、版本对比等高级功能。例如执行
compare /reports/2023.xlsx /reports/2024.xlsx可生成差异分析报告。 - 进程管理:可监控后台服务状态,在检测到异常时自动重启并发送告警。配置示例:
{"monitor_rules": [{"service_name": "nginx","check_interval": 30,"restart_command": "systemctl restart nginx"}]}
3. 开发工具链支持
- 代码辅助生成:根据自然语言描述生成可执行代码片段,支持Python/Java/SQL等主流语言。例如输入”用Pandas处理销售数据并生成柱状图”可返回完整脚本。
- 调试环境集成:内置终端模拟器,可直接执行Shell命令进行问题排查。敏感操作(如sudo)需二次验证身份。
三、典型应用场景与价值验证
在多个行业实践中,Clawdbot展现出显著效率提升:
1. 企业知识管理
某金融公司部署后,实现:
- 文档自动归档:通过对话指令将聊天记录中的关键信息提取为结构化数据
- 智能检索:支持模糊查询”2023年Q2利润超过500万的项目”,返回匹配的Excel报表
- 权限控制:不同部门员工仅能访问授权范围内的知识库内容
2. 研发效能提升
开发团队利用其构建自动化工作流:
# 自定义任务脚本示例def deploy_application():git_pull()build_docker_image()run_tests()if tests_passed():notify_team("Deployment successful")else:rollback_changes()
通过自然语言调用该脚本,非技术成员也可完成部署操作。
3. 运维自动化
在某数据中心实践中,系统实现:
- 7×24小时监控:每5分钟检查服务器负载,异常时自动扩容
- 故障自愈:检测到服务宕机后,按预设策略尝试重启或切换备用节点
- 变更审计:所有操作记录存入区块链存证系统,满足合规要求
四、技术挑战与演进方向
尽管优势显著,本地化AI智能体仍面临三大挑战:
- 资源消耗平衡:模型推理与任务执行需优化CPU/GPU利用率,某测试案例显示,在4核8G服务器上可同时处理20个并发任务
- 安全边界定义:需建立更精细的权限模型,例如限制对生产数据库的写操作
- 跨平台兼容:当前Windows支持度有待提升,社区正在开发WSL2集成方案
未来演进可能聚焦于:
- 引入联邦学习机制,在保护数据隐私前提下实现模型协同优化
- 开发可视化任务编排工具,降低非技术人员定制流程的门槛
- 与边缘计算结合,构建分布式智能体网络
这种本地化AI执行框架的兴起,标志着人机协作进入新阶段。开发者可通过开源社区持续获取功能更新,企业用户则能在数据主权与智能化之间找到平衡点。随着技术成熟,预计未来3年内将有30%的中大型企业部署此类解决方案,重新定义数字化工作方式。